What is r-cran-rcppannoy

r-cran-rcppannoy is:

‘Annoy’ is a small C++ library for Approximate Nearest Neighbors written for efficient memory usage as well an ability to load from / save to disk. This package provides an R interface by relying on the ‘Rcpp’ package, exposing the same interface as the original Python wrapper to ‘Annoy’.

There are three methods to install r-cran-rcppannoy on Kali Linux. We can use apt-get, apt and aptitude. In the following sections we will describe each method. You can choose one of them.

Install r-cran-rcppannoy Using apt-get

Update apt database with apt-get using the following command.

sudo apt-get update

After updating apt database, We can install r-cran-rcppannoy using apt-get by running the following command:

sudo apt-get -y install r-cran-rcppannoy

How To Uninstall r-cran-rcppannoy on Kali Linux

To uninstall only the r-cran-rcppannoy package we can use the following command:

sudo apt-get remove r-cran-rcppannoy

Uninstall r-cran-rcppannoy And Its Dependencies

To uninstall r-cran-rcppannoy and its dependencies that are no longer needed by Kali Linux, we can use the command below:

sudo apt-get -y autoremove r-cran-rcppannoy

Remove r-cran-rcppannoy Configurations and Data

To remove r-cran-rcppannoy configuration and data from Kali Linux we can use the following command:

sudo apt-get -y purge r-cran-rcppannoy

Remove r-cran-rcppannoy configuration, data, and all of its dependencies

We can use the following command to remove r-cran-rcppannoy configurations, data and all of its dependencies, we can use the following command:

sudo apt-get -y autoremove --purge r-cran-rcppannoy
